What are the main differences between snickers and tofu?

  • Snickers is richer in fiber, while tofu is higher in iron and calcium.
  • Snickers's daily need coverage for saturated fat is 60% higher.
  • Tofu has 75 times less sugar than snickers. Snickers has 46.54g of sugar, while tofu has 0.62g.
  • Snickers has a higher glycemic index (51) than tofu (15).

We used Candies, MARS SNACKFOOD US, SNICKERS CRUNCHER and Tofu, raw, regular, prepared with calcium sulfate types in this comparison.
